Hello community, here is the log from the commit of package tryton for openSUSE:Factory checked in at 2019-07-17 13:14:46 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/tryton (Old) and /work/SRC/openSUSE:Factory/.tryton.new.1887 (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"tryton" Wed Jul 17 13:14:46 2019 rev:30 rq:714986 version:4.6.21 Changes: -------- --- /work/SRC/openSUSE:Factory/tryton/tryton.changes 2019-06-01 09:48:02.763354064 +0200 +++ /work/SRC/openSUSE:Factory/.tryton.new.1887/tryton.changes 2019-07-17 13:14:52.231830452 +0200 @@ -1,0 +2,5 @@ +Fri Jul 12 17:20:27 UTC 2019 - Axel Braun <[email protected]> + +- Version 4.6.21 - Bugfix Release + +------------------------------------------------------------------- Old: ---- tryton-4.6.19.tar.gz New: ---- tryton-4.6.21.tar.gz 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 tryton.spec ++++++ --- /var/tmp/diff_new_pack.aeSniU/_old 2019-07-17 13:14:53.187829988 +0200 +++ /var/tmp/diff_new_pack.aeSniU/_new 2019-07-17 13:14:53.191829986 +0200 @@ -19,7 +19,7 @@ %define majorver 4.6 Name: tryton -Version: %{majorver}.19 +Version: %{majorver}.21 Release: 0 Summary: The client of the Tryton application platform License: GPL-3.0-only ++++++ tryton-4.6.19.tar.gz -> tryton-4.6.21.tar.gz ++++++ di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/tryton-4.6.19/.hgtags new/tryton-4.6.21/.hgtags --- old/tryton-4.6.19/.hgtags 2019-05-16 17:42:55.000000000 +0200 +++ new/tryton-4.6.21/.hgtags 2019-07-01 21:37:09.000000000 +0200 @@ -36,3 +36,5 @@ fa719654625129392702265195210c470f0cc2fc 4.6.17 dd7b6493809d64fa3fdafba7ea3a250eb0a8f724 4.6.18 15d54cd5d0a7ddef4002e627903a90c6ab942149 4.6.19 +73a5a3a71476466a10c19c3344523f2aeadbe74e 4.6.20 +8e54efd58b258863ff27f5e49f08310ac1fd0ed0 4.6.21 di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/tryton-4.6.19/CHANGELOG new/tryton-4.6.21/CHANGELOG --- old/tryton-4.6.19/CHANGELOG 2019-05-16 17:42:55.000000000 +0200 +++ new/tryton-4.6.21/CHANGELOG 2019-07-01 21:37:09.000000000 +0200 @@ -1,3 +1,9 @@ +Version 4.6.21 - 2019-07-01 +* Bug fixes (see mercurial logs for details) + +Version 4.6.20 - 2019-06-10 +* Bug fixes (see mercurial logs for details) + Version 4.6.19 - 2019-05-16 * Bug fixes (see mercurial logs for details) di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/tryton-4.6.19/PKG-INFO new/tryton-4.6.21/PKG-INFO --- old/tryton-4.6.19/PKG-INFO 2019-05-16 17:42:57.000000000 +0200 +++ new/tryton-4.6.21/PKG-INFO 2019-07-01 21:37:10.000000000 +0200 @@ -1,6 +1,6 @@ Metadata-Version: 2.1 Name: tryton -Version: 4.6.19 +Version: 4.6.21 Summary: Tryton client Home-page: http://www.tryton.org/ Author: Tryton di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/tryton-4.6.19/tryton/__init__.py new/tryton-4.6.21/tryton/__init__.py --- old/tryton-4.6.19/tryton/__init__.py 2019-04-02 21:38:36.000000000 +0200 +++ new/tryton-4.6.21/tryton/__init__.py 2019-06-10 18:32:32.000000000 +0200 @@ -1,3 +1,3 @@ # This file is part of Tryton. The COPYRIGHT file at the top level of # this repository contains the full copyright notices and license terms. -__version__ = "4.6.19" +__version__ = "4.6.21" Binary files old/tryton-4.6.19/tryton/data/locale/bg/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/bg/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/ca/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/ca/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/cs/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/cs/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/de/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/de/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/es/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/es/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/es_419/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/es_419/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/fr/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/fr/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/hu_HU/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/hu_HU/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/it_IT/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/it_IT/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/ja_JP/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/ja_JP/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/lo/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/lo/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/lt/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/lt/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/nl/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/nl/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/pl/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/pl/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/pt_BR/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/pt_BR/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/ru/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/ru/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/sl/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/sl/LC_MESSAGES/tryton.mo differ Binary files old/tryton-4.6.19/tryton/data/locale/zh_CN/LC_MESSAGES/tryton.mo and new/tryton-4.6.21/tryton/data/locale/zh_CN/LC_MESSAGES/tryton.mo differ di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/tryton-4.6.19/tryton/gui/window/revision.py new/tryton-4.6.21/tryton/gui/window/revision.py --- old/tryton-4.6.19/tryton/gui/window/revision.py 2018-08-20 22:55:19.000000000 +0200 +++ new/tryton-4.6.21/tryton/gui/window/revision.py 2019-06-12 21:47:19.000000000 +0200 @@ -5,6 +5,8 @@ from tryton.config import TRYTON_ICON from tryton.common import get_toplevel_window +from tryton.common import (get_toplevel_window, + timezoned_date, untimezoned_date) from tryton.common.datetime_strftime import datetime_strftime from tryton.common.datetime_ import date_parse @@ -48,7 +50,8 @@ active = 0 list_store.append(('', '')) for i, (rev, id_, name) in enumerate(revisions, 1): - list_store.append((datetime_strftime(rev, self._format), name)) + list_store.append( + (datetime_strftime(timezoned_date(rev), self._format), name)) if rev == revision: active = i combobox.set_active(active) @@ -83,7 +86,7 @@ value = None if text: try: - value = date_parse(text, self._format) + value = untimezoned_date(date_parse(text, self._format)) except ValueError: pass self._value = value di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/tryton-4.6.19/tryton/gui/window/view_form/screen/screen.py new/tryton-4.6.21/tryton/gui/window/view_form/screen/screen.py --- old/tryton-4.6.19/tryton/gui/window/view_form/screen/screen.py 2018-11-03 01:24:42.000000000 +0100 +++ new/tryton-4.6.21/tryton/gui/window/view_form/screen/screen.py 2019-05-17 12:46:12.000000000 +0200 @@ -294,6 +294,7 @@ domain = self.domain_parser.parse(search_string) else: domain = self.search_value + self.search_value = None if set_text: self.screen_container.set_text( self.domain_parser.string(domain)) @@ -1169,8 +1170,11 @@ path = [rpc._DATABASE, 'model', self.model_name] view_ids = [v.view_id for v in self.views] + self.view_ids if self.current_view.view_type != 'form': - search_string = self.screen_container.get_text() - search_value = self.domain_parser.parse(search_string) + if self.search_value: + search_value = self.search_value + else: + search_string = self.screen_container.get_text() + search_value = self.domain_parser.parse(search_string) if search_value: query_string.append(('search_value', json.dumps( search_value, cls=JSONEncoder, di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/tryton-4.6.19/tryton/gui/window/view_form/view/list.py new/tryton-4.6.21/tryton/gui/window/view_form/view/list.py --- old/tryton-4.6.19/tryton/gui/window/view_form/view/list.py 2019-03-06 23:59:35.000000000 +0100 +++ new/tryton-4.6.21/tryton/gui/window/view_form/view/list.py 2019-05-17 12:46:12.000000000 +0200 @@ -833,6 +833,9 @@ gtk.gdk.drop_finish(context, False, etime) else: context.drop_finish(False, etime) + selection = self.treeview.get_selection() + selection.unselect_all() + selection.select_path(record.get_index_path(model.group)) if self.attributes.get('sequence'): record.group.set_sequence(field=self.attributes['sequence']) return True diff -urN '--exclude=CVS' '--exclude=.cvsignore' '--exclude=.svn' '--exclude=.svnignore' old/tryton-4.6.19/tryton.egg-info/PKG-INFO new/tryton-4.6.21/tryton.egg-info/PKG-INFO --- old/tryton-4.6.19/tryton.egg-info/PKG-INFO 2019-05-16 17:42:56.000000000 +0200 +++ new/tryton-4.6.21/tryton.egg-info/PKG-INFO 2019-07-01 21:37:10.000000000 +0200 @@ -1,6 +1,6 @@ Metadata-Version: 2.1 Name: tryton -Version: 4.6.19 +Version: 4.6.21 Summary: Tryton client Home-page: http://www.tryton.org/ Author: Tryton
